This website contains lectures, homework, exams, and other materials for a PER-based large lecture modern physics course for engineering majors. This course has redesigned content and learning techniques focused on topics more useful to engineering majors than a traditional modern physics course. The course emphasizes reasoning development, model building, and connections to real world applications. A variety of PER-based learning resources, including peer instruction, collaborative homework sessions, and interactive simulations, are used. Research results on learning outcomes from the course are included.
